Douglas Emmett, Inc. (NYSE: DEI) is a fully integrated, self-administered and self-managed real estate investment trust (REIT) and one of the largest owners and operators of high-quality office and multifamily properties in the premier coastal submarkets of Los Angeles and Honolulu. In addition, the company issues news related to financing and capital markets activities, such as new secured, non-recourse, interest-only loans used to refinance existing property-level debt. For example, Douglas Emmett has reported refinancing multiple residential properties and repaying the debt on The Landmark Residences (formerly Barrington Plaza), adding it to its pool of unencumbered assets.

Douglas Emmett, Inc. (NYSE: DEI) has announced a quarterly cash dividend of $0.19 per share, totaling $0.76 annually. The payment is scheduled for April 14, 2023, to shareholders on record as of March 31, 2023. org value="NYSE:DEI"Douglas Emmett, Inc. announced the tax treatment of its 2022 common stock dividends, advising shareholders to consult tax advisors regarding their specific tax impacts. The press release details dividends paid on January 19, 2022, and January 18, 2023, per share amounts of $0.28 and $0.19, with allocations to their respective tax years. Total dividends for 2022 amount to $1.12, while qualifying ordinary income is reported as $0.6216 per share. The company focuses on high-quality properties in Los Angeles and Honolulu.

Douglas Emmett, Inc. (NYSE: DEI) has authorized a new share repurchase program allowing up to $300 million of its common shares to be repurchased. This initiative aims to enhance shareholder value and may be executed at management's discretion based on market conditions, stock prices, and alternative capital uses. The company retains the right to suspend or terminate the buyback program at any time. Douglas Emmett focuses on high-quality office and multifamily properties in Los Angeles and Honolulu.
